About Advanced Health Care Of Las Vegas

Advanced Health Care of Las Vegas is a short-term nursing and rehabilitation facility located in Las Vegas, Nevada. The community specializes in post-acute recovery, offering personalized care designed to help patients transition from hospital settings back to independence and home life.

The facility provides 24-hour nursing care delivered by licensed nurses on staff around the clock. Each patient receives a deluxe private suite with a private bathroom and shower, adjustable bed with pressure-relieving mattress, television, private phone, and high-speed internet access. The medical team, including doctors, nurses, therapists, and dietitians, develops customized treatment plans focused on maximizing each patient's independence and quality of life through comprehensive evaluation and assessment.

Inpatient rehabilitation services are central to the community's offerings, along with transportation and fine dining. The facility features restaurant-style dining in an elegant setting with meals prepared by on-staff chefs and dietitians, tailored to meet individual nutritional needs and preferences. Additional amenities include a library, beauty salon, private dining room, and fireplace.

The community is recognized by the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services for high-quality care standards. Visitors are welcome and encouraged as part of the recovery process, and the facility has partnerships with hospital systems, accountable care organizations, and insurance networks.

I can’t say enough wonderful things about Advanced Healthcare of Las Vegas. My Mom fell and broke her hip three weeks ago and it’s scary not knowing what to do when she was released from the hospital or where to take her to heal. From the moment we arrived, the entire experience exceeded expectations. The staff is truly exceptional—kind, patient, and genuinely attentive. The nurses and CNAs go above and beyond to make sure every need is met with compassion and care. You can tell they truly care about their patients. The physical and occupational therapists are outstanding. Their expertise, encouragement, and dedication made such a difference in the recovery process. The facility itself is clean, well-maintained, and comfortable. The private rooms are beautiful and spacious—it honestly feels more like a hotel than a hospital, which makes such a difference during recovery. Grateful for the incredible care and support.
